What metal is used in diecast?
Manufacturers carefully select the metals used in the die-casting process to achieve optimal results in a variety of applications. The main metals used in die-casting include aluminum, zinc, magnesium, and brass. Each metal has its unique advantages: aluminum is known for its lightweight and durability; zinc is economical and ideal for small parts; magnesium is extremely lightweight, helping to reduce overall weight in critical applications; and brass is rust-resistant and easy to form.
